Marina Christmas Boat Parade Set

About 55,000 people are expected to attend Saturday’s 26th annual Marina del Rey Christmas Boat Parade, which begins at 5:30 p.m.

“Christmas Dreams” is the theme of the 2-hour parade, sponsored by the Pioneer Skippers Boat Owners Assn., a nonprofit organization dedicated to promoting safe family boating.

Actress Cloris Leachman is the parade grand marshal.

Other celebrities expected to ride in the electrical-light parade include John Considine of “Another World,” Monica Hyland of “General Hospital,” James Crittenten of “Paradise,” Lee Benton of “Mike Hammer” and the Los Angeles Raiders cheerleaders.

The parade of about 70 decorated yachts through the marina’s main channel can best be viewed from Fisherman’s Village on Fiji Way, Burton Chace Park at the west end of Mindanao Way and the north or south jetties, accessible from Pacific Avenue and Vista Del Mar, according to parade spokeswoman Margaret Clare.

Parking in the county’s 11 lots at the marina will be free after 4 p.m.

The parade is financed by boat entry fees, donations and advertising in a souvenir program. A portion of the proceeds will be donated to a charity for abused children.
